Union Cabinet approves Rare Earth Permanent Magnet manufacturing scheme worth ₹7,280 crore

Union Minister Ashwini Vaishnaw during Cabinet decision briefing on November 26, 2025. Photo: YouTube/PIB India The Union Cabinet on Wednesday (November 26, 2025) approved the ‘Scheme to Promote Manufacturing of Sintered Rare Earth Permanent Magnets’ with a financial outlay of ₹7,280 crore. At present, India’s demand for REPMs is met primarily through imports. “This first-of-its-kind…
